Safflower (Carthamus tinctorius L.) is one of the oldest domesticated crops, mainly grown as oilseed in the arid and semi-arid regions of the world. This study was conducted to investigate the cardinal temperature of some Carthamus species and to identify the effects of drought stress on its seeds germination aspects. For this purpose, seeds of 13 genotypes from five species including C. tinctorius, C. palaestinus, C. oxyacantha, C. glaucus and C. lanatus which were harvested from drought stressed and non-stressed plants were used. Then, they were subjected to 9 fixed temperatures (5°C, 10°C, 15°C, 20°C, 25°C, 30°C, 35°C, 40°C and 45°C) according to a factorial experiment in a growth chamber during germination. Results showed that the effect of genotype, species, temperature, drought stress pre-treatment and some of their interactions were significant on germination characteristics. Significant reductions occurred in the germination rate of seeds at temperatures less than 10 °C and upper than 30 °C. This experiment showed that cardinal temperatures more likely will not be problematic in the case of inter-specific breeding programs. However, there were significant differences in germination percentage of seeds among species. The results showed that seeds which were harvested from drought stressed plants did not show a significant difference in cardinal temperature but the germination percentage significantly decreased in comparison with the ones harvested from plants at normal moisture condition.
